首页  / srvsvc.dll
srvsvc.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:298 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.4355
选择系统
windows10
选择版本
选择位数
32位
立即下载

srvsvc.dll的核心功能与缺少DLL的影响


srvsvc.dll的核心功能


srvsvc.dll是Windows操作系统中一个关键的动态链接库文件,全称为“Server Service DLL”。它属于Windows Server服务(Server Service)的核心组件,主要集成在Windows NT内核系统(如Windows 10、Windows Server系列)中。该DLL文件位于系统目录(通常为C:WindowsSystem32)下,负责管理和协调网络共享相关的底层操作。其核心功能围绕服务器消息块(SMB)协议实现,确保文件和打印机共享服务的高效运行。



具体来说,srvsvc.dll的核心功能包括:



  • 文件和打印机共享管理:作为Server Service的一部分,srvsvc.dll处理网络共享资源的创建、访问和权限控制。它支持SMB协议(如SMB 2.0/3.0),允许用户在局域网或域环境中共享文件夹和打印机,实现数据交换和资源协同。

  • 网络服务协调:该DLL与Workstation服务(lanmanworkstation)紧密交互,协调客户端和服务器之间的通信。它管理远程过程调用(RPC),确保网络请求(如文件读取或打印作业)能被正确处理,同时优化数据传输性能。

  • 系统API支持:srvsvc.dll提供一组应用程序编程接口(API),供其他Windows服务和应用程序调用。例如,它支持netapi32.dll中的函数,用于网络管理任务(如查询共享状态或启动/停止服务),增强了系统的可扩展性和兼容性。

  • 安全与权限验证:在共享资源访问中,srvsvc.dll参与用户身份验证和权限检查。它结合安全账户管理器(SAM)和活动目录(AD),确保只有授权用户才能访问共享文件或打印机,防止未授权操作。

  • 故障恢复与日志记录:该DLL内置错误处理机制,能记录共享服务的运行日志到事件查看器(Event Viewer)。这有助于诊断网络问题,并在服务中断时尝试自动恢复,维持系统稳定性。



总体而言,srvsvc.dll是Windows网络架构的基石。它在后台运行,确保企业环境或家庭网络中的共享功能无缝运作。如果该DLL正常,用户可以通过“网络”选项卡或命令行工具(如net share)轻松管理共享资源。


缺少srvsvc.dll可能的影响


如果srvsvc.dll文件缺失、损坏或未正确注册,会导致Server Service无法启动或运行异常。这种问题可能由病毒攻击、系统更新错误、软件冲突或手动删除引起。缺少该DLL的影响范围广泛,从基本功能失效到系统不稳定,具体表现如下:



关键影响包括:



  • 文件和打印机共享功能完全失效:用户无法创建、访问或管理网络共享资源。例如,尝试映射网络驱动器时会失败,错误消息显示“网络路径未找到”或“服务不可用”。打印作业也无法发送到共享打印机,严重影响办公效率。

  • Server Service启动失败:在服务管理器(services.msc)中,Server Service状态可能显示“已停止”或“启动错误”。系统日志(Event Viewer)会记录事件ID 7024或7000,提示“srvsvc.dll加载失败”或“服务未响应”。这可能导致依赖该服务的其他组件(如Computer Browser服务)连锁崩溃。

  • 网络连接问题:缺少srvsvc.dll会破坏SMB协议的正常运作。用户可能无法加入域环境,或遇到网络发现(Network Discovery)功能失灵。在客户端设备上,访问共享文件夹时会出现超时错误或权限拒绝提示。

  • 系统不稳定与错误消息:启动Windows时,可能弹出DLL缺失警告(如“srvsvc.dll未找到”)。严重情况下,系统会进入安全模式或蓝屏死机(BSOD),错误代码如SYSTEM_SERVICE_EXCEPTION。应用程序(如文件资源管理器或第三方网络工具)也可能崩溃。

  • 安全风险增加:由于权限验证机制受损,未授权用户可能获得共享资源访问权限。此外,系统漏洞更容易被利用,例如通过恶意软件注入,导致数据泄露或进一步损坏。



在日常使用中,这些影响会显著降低用户体验,尤其在依赖网络共享的企业环境中。为避免此类问题,建议定期进行系统扫描和备份,并使用SFC(系统文件检查器)工具修复DLL文件。